In "The Interdependence of Literature," Georgina Pell Curtis embarks on an insightful exploration of the interconnectedness among various literary traditions and genres throughout history. The book stylistically blends critical analysis with engaging prose, revealing the ways in which literature both shapes and is shaped by cultural, social, and historical contexts. Through a careful examination of canonical texts and lesser-known works, Curtis illustrates how themes, motifs, and narrative structures recur across literary landscapes, creating a rich tapestry of human experience and creativity. Georgina Pell Curtis, a distinguished scholar in literary studies, has dedicated her career to understanding the mechanisms that bind literature to the human soul. Her extensive background in comparative literature and cultural analysis informs her writing, allowing her to draw enlightening parallels between diverse literary works. Curtis's passion for fostering appreciation for underrepresented voices in literature is evident in her analytical approach, making this book a significant contribution to both academic circles and literary enthusiasts alike.
